Hacker News

Zabawa z emotikonami Shell

Zabawa z emotikonami Shell Ta wszechstronna analiza powłoki oferuje szczegółowe zbadanie jej podstawowych komponentów i szerszych implikacji — Mewayz Business OS.

8 min. przeczytaj

Mewayz Team

Editorial Team

Hacker News

Zabawa z emotikonami Shell

Ta wszechstronna analiza powłoki oferuje szczegółowe zbadanie jej podstawowych komponentów i szerszych implikacji.

Kluczowe obszary zainteresowania

Dyskusja koncentruje się na:

Podstawowe mechanizmy i procesy

Zagadnienia dotyczące implementacji w świecie rzeczywistym

Analiza porównawcza z powiązanymi podejściami

Dowody empiryczne i studia przypadków

Szerszy kontekst

Badanie muszli w jej większym ekosystemie ujawnia ważne powiązania i zależności systemowe.

Często zadawane pytania

Co to są emoji powłoki i jak są używane w środowiskach terminalowych?

💡 DID YOU KNOW?

Mewayz replaces 8+ business tools in one platform

CRM · Invoicing · HR · Projects · Booking · eCommerce · POS · Analytics. Free forever plan available.

Zacznij za darmo →

Emoji powłoki to znaki Unicode renderowane bezpośrednio w interfejsach wiersza poleceń i emulatorach terminali. Nowoczesne powłoki, takie jak Zsh i Fish, obsługują emoji w podpowiedziach, wynikach skryptów i nazwach katalogów. Dodają wizualnej przejrzystości do wskaźników stanu, komunikatów o błędach i niestandardowych motywów podpowiedzi, dzięki czemu przepływy pracy terminala są bardziej czytelne i wyraziste, bez poświęcania funkcjonalności i wydajności.

Czy emoji powłoki można używać w skryptach i potokach automatyzacji?

Absolutnie. Emotikony można osadzać w skryptach bash lub zsh jako znaczniki stanu – ✅ sukcesu, ❌ niepowodzenia, ⚙️ przetwarzania – poprawiając czytelność dziennika na pierwszy rzut oka. Podczas zarządzania zautomatyzowanymi przepływami pracy, takimi jak te wbudowane w platformy biznesowe, takie jak Mewayz (biznesowy system operacyjny z 207 modułami, 19 USD miesięcznie na app.mewayz.com), wyraźne efekty wizualne w skryptach znacznie skracają czas debugowania.

Czy występują problemy ze zgodnością emoji powłoki w różnych systemach operacyjnych?

Zgodność zależy od emulatora terminala, czcionki i ustawień regionalnych. Większość nowoczesnych terminali w systemach macOS, Linux i Windows Terminal poprawnie renderuje emoji, gdy aktywne jest kodowanie UTF-8. Zamiast tego starsze systemy lub minimalne środowiska serwerowe mogą wyświetlać znaki zastępcze. Zawsze testuj dane wyjściowe emoji w środowisku docelowym przed wdrożeniem skryptów korzystających ze wskaźników czytelności opartych na emoji.

W jaki sposób emoji powłoki mogą poprawić produktywność zespołu i komunikację w toku pracy?

Wskazówki wizualne z emotikonów zmniejszają obciążenie poznawcze podczas skanowania wyników dziennika lub wyników potoku CI/CD, umożliwiając zespołom szybszą identyfikację problemów. W przypadku firm zarządzających wieloma narzędziami i procesami — na przykład tych centralizujących operacje za pośrednictwem Mewayz (app.mewayz.com) — dodanie konwencji emoji do wewnętrznych skryptów i wyników automatyzacji tworzy spójny, przyjazny dla człowieka interfejs, który poprawia wdrażanie zespołu i codzienną wydajność operacyjną.

{"@context":"https:\/\/schema.org","@type":"FAQPage","mainEntity":[{"@type":"Question","name":"Co to są emoji powłoki i jak się ich używa w środowiskach terminalowych?","acceptedAnswer":{"@type":"Answer","text":"Emoji powłoki to znaki Unicode renderowane bezpośrednio w interfejsach wiersza poleceń i emulatorach terminali. Nowoczesne powłoki takie jak Zsh i Fish obsługują emoji w podpowiedziach, wynikach skryptów i nazwach katalogów. Zwiększają przejrzystość wizualną wskaźników stanu, komunikatów o błędach i niestandardowych motywach podpowiedzi, dzięki czemu przepływy pracy terminala są bardziej czytelne i wyraziste bez poświęcania funkcjonalności i wydajności."}},{"@type":"Pytanie","name":"Czy emoji powłoki można używać w skryptach i automatyzacji. potoki?","acceptedAnswer":{"@type":"Answer","text":"Bez wątpienia emotikony można osadzać w skryptach bash lub zsh jako znaczniki stanu w przypadku sukcesu, \u274c w przypadku niepowodzenia, \u2699\ufe0f do przetwarzania\u2014polepszenia czytelności dzienników w skrócie podczas zarządzania automatycznymi przepływami pracy, takimi jak te wbudowane w platformy biznesowe Mewayz (207-modułowy system operacyjny dla firm, 19 USD/mies. na app.mewayz.com), przejrzyste efekty wizualne w skryptach znacznie skracają czas debugowania."}},{"@type":"Question","name":"Czy występują problemy ze zgodnością z emoji powłoki w różnych systemach operacyjnych?","acceptedAnswer":{"@type":"Answer","text":"Zgodność zależy od emulatora terminala, czcionki i ustawień regionalnych większości nowoczesnych terminali macOS, Linu

Frequently Asked Questions

Co to są emoji powłoki i jak są używane w środowiskach terminalowych?

Emoji powłoki to znaki Unicode wyświetlane bezpośrednio w interfejsie wiersza poleceń (CLI). Są używane do wizualnego wzbogacania skryptów bash, komunikatów systemowych oraz promptów terminala. Dzięki nim skrypty stają się bardziej czytelne i intuicyjne. Obsługa emoji zależy od wersji terminala oraz kodowania znaków — większość nowoczesnych środowisk (Linux, macOS, Windows Terminal) obsługuje je natywnie przez standard UTF-8.

Jak dodać emoji do skryptu bash bez błędów kodowania?

Aby bezpiecznie używać emoji w skryptach bash, należy upewnić się, że plik jest zapisany w kodowaniu UTF-8 oraz że zmienna środowiskowa LANG jest ustawiona na wartość obsługującą Unicode, np. en_US.UTF-8. Emoji wstawiamy bezpośrednio w ciąg znaków lub przez sekwencję ucieczki \U. Warto też testować skrypty na różnych terminalach, aby wykluczyć problemy z renderowaniem znaków specjalnych.

Czy emoji w powłoce mogą wpłynąć na wydajność lub automatyzację procesów biznesowych?

Emoji same w sobie mają minimalny wpływ na wydajność, jednak w rozbudowanych systemach automatyzacji warto je stosować z umiarem. Platformy takie jak Mewayz — biznesowy system operacyjny z 207 modułami dostępny od 19 USD miesięcznie na app.mewayz.com — umożliwiają automatyzację złożonych procesów bez konieczności ręcznego pisania skryptów. To wygodna alternatywa dla firm, które chcą usprawnić działanie bez zagłębiania się w szczegóły konfiguracji powłoki.

Jakie narzędzia pomagają zarządzać emoji i skryptami powłoki w środowisku produkcyjnym?

W środowisku produkcyjnym przydatne są edytory obsługujące Unicode (VS Code, Vim z odpowiednią konfiguracją) oraz narzędzia do lintowania skryptów, takie jak ShellCheck. Dla firm szukających kompleksowego rozwiązania do zarządzania procesami i automatyzacją — bez potrzeby pisania skryptów — Mewayz oferuje gotowe moduły do obsługi zadań operacyjnych. Platforma dostępna pod adresem app.mewayz.com łączy narzędzia biznesowe w jednym miejscu, eliminując potrzebę utrzymywania rozproszonych skryptów powłoki.

Try Mewayz Free

All-in-one platform for CRM, invoicing, projects, HR & more. No credit card required.

Start managing your business smarter today

Join 30,000+ businesses. Free forever plan · No credit card required.

Uznałeś to za przydatne? Udostępnij to.

Ready to put this into practice?

Join 30,000+ businesses using Mewayz. Free forever plan — no credit card required.

Rozpocznij darmowy okres próbny →

Gotowy, by podjąć działanie?

Rozpocznij swój darmowy okres próbny Mewayz dziś

Platforma biznesowa wszystko w jednym. Karta kredytowa nie jest wymagana.

Zacznij za darmo →

14-day free trial · No credit card · Cancel anytime